“‘Tis the Season” A Holiday Celebration         December 12 and 13, 2008

Celebrate the holidays Rocky Mountain style with “‘Tis the Season,” a concert to benefit the VPAC’s Community Performance Fund (see page 46). Talented performers from around the Vail Valley descend on the Vilar Center stage for an unforgettable evening of song, theatre and dance. The showcase evening features several local performing groups, in addition to the talent of Vail Valley professional musicians, who donate their time and talent to support “Home for the Holidays.” Past artists have included Pat Hamilton, Beth Swearingen, Peter Vavra and Don Watson. In 2008, performing companies in “Home for the Holidays” will include:

Vail Youth Ballet was formed by Friends of the Dance in 1996 to provide performance opportunities and training for the advanced ballet students in Eagle County. Since its inception, the Company has performed with David Taylor Dance Theatre, Cleo Parker Robinson Dance Ensemble and danced all the principal roles in “The Nutcracker Suite.”

Vail Performing Arts Academy was founded to meet the growing demand for performing arts opportunities for local students ranging from 8 to 18 years old. The VPAA promotes the four “Cs”: Cooperation, Confidence, Creativity and Communication through the study of theatre.

Mountain Harmony has been performing throughout Colorado for nearly 20 years. With tight a cappella harmonies and ringing chords, this ladies’ form of barbershop music has become an American folk art.

Dickens Carolers, also known as the Vail Community Chorale, have performed together for more than 20 years. The volunteer group brings the Christmas spirit to all by dressing in period costumes and performing on streets in the Vail Valley throughout the holiday season.
